How can integrating works of art into the classroom provide opportunities to explore and grapple with multiple perspectives on American history? Join National Gallery of Art museum educators Liz Diament and Julie Carmean to look closely and discuss two powerful artworks that focus on the Native American experience historically and today. Using thinking routines from Arts as Civic Commons by Project Zero, we will model teaching tools to facilitate complex conversations in the classroom.
